Online & Distance Learning at Roger Williams University
Many students take online classes at Roger Williams University. Among 4,350 students, 364 (8%) were enrolled entirely in distance education and 410 (9%) took at least some classes online.

Best-Paid Careers for General Journalism Graduates
Students who finish General Journalism program at Roger Williams University go on to a range of careers. Here are the top-paying careers for General Journalism majors, ordered by median annual salary:
| Occupation | Nationwide Median Wage |
|---|---|
| Editors | $100,346 |
| Communications Teachers, Postsecondary | $96,169 |
| News Analysts, Reporters, and Journalists | $74,101 |
| Poets, Lyricists and Creative Writers | $70,619 |
| Writers and Authors | $63,195 |
| Proofreaders and Copy Markers | $30,503 |
